The Core Truth: Server Logs Don’t Lie
Most SEOs never look at server logs.
They stay focused on surface metrics: traffic, rankings, click-through rates.
But the breakthroughs live in the raw data.
Server logs show you what bots actually do – how they crawl, what they skip, where your site is leaking performance. They reveal the truth beneath the dashboard.
